Analysis
The most recent figure for state capacity index in Democratic Republic of Congo is -0.9912, measured in 2015.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 6.4% on the previous year and up 29.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, state capacity index in Democratic Republic of Congo peaked at -0.9417 in 1978 and was at its lowest, -1.59, in 2009.
Democratic Republic of Congo ranks 156th of 165 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 56 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| -1.26 | -1.49 | -1.05 | 10 |
| 1970s | -1.1 | -1.22 | -0.9417 | 10 |
| 1980s | -1.16 | -1.27 | -1.04 | 10 |
| 1990s | -1.33 | -1.47 | -1.2 | 10 |
| 2000s | -1.32 | -1.59 | -0.9817 | 10 |
| 2010s | -1.22 | -1.54 | -0.9912 | 6 |

About this data
Measures state capacity by combining 21 different indicators related to three key dimensions: extractive capacity, coercive capacity, and administrative capacity. Higher values indicate greater state capacity.
